We’re looking for a skilled and motivated Network Engineer to design, implement, and maintain secure and reliable network infrastructure. This role is ideal for professionals who enjoy troubleshooting, optimizing network performance, and working in a collaborative, remote-first environment.

🎯 Key Responsibilities

Design, implement, and maintain LAN, WAN, VPN, and cloud-based network infrastructures.

Monitor network performance, availability, and security; troubleshoot and resolve network issues.

Configure and manage network hardware such as routers, switches, firewalls, and load balancers.

Ensure network security through best practices, access controls, and regular updates.

Collaborate with system administrators, cloud engineers, and IT teams to support business operations.

Document network configurations, procedures, and troubleshooting guides.

Participate in network upgrades, migrations, and disaster recovery planning.

✅ Requirements

1–3 years of experience in network engineering, IT infrastructure, or related roles.

Solid understanding of T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, VLANs, VPNs, and routing protocols.

Experience with network devices (e.g., Cisco, Juniper, Fortinet, Ubiquiti, or similar).

Familiarity with cloud networking (AWS, Azure, or GCP) is a strong plus.

Basic scripting or automation skills (e.g., Bash, Python) are an advantage.

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.

Ability to work independently in a remote environment.

Fluent in English.

Based in Australia with legal right to work full-time.
